Life of an Intern

Entering Internship after clearing the final MBBS was like a dream waiting to come true during those 4 n a half yrs….After all the hard work, getting to put the stethoscope around ur neck n walking along the corridors of the hospital when someone calls u “DOCTOR” from behind….sounds really nice!!but that’s all which is nice about internship…

March - Walking in the OBG wards on the first day…doing a night duty there on the second….searching for postnatal woman in postnatal ward only to find her in gynaec ward…filling investigation forms…checking bp’s..writing afternoon notes…posted in srirampura for the periphery postings…gave my first individual prescriptions in the opd…nothing more than diclo,pct n cpm….:)

April – Pediatrics was hectic….8-9 duties in the month….all 36 hrs….sleeping on the 5 foot sofa in the breastfeeding room in new hospital picu….rounds with dr.maiya was the only good part of it…

May – Back to OBG…same old story…ya forgot to mention about running to the lab to collect reports of the investigations….running around searching for murnal to get free n 50% concession signatures…Was sent to Chennai to attend the Ethicon Suturing workshop with ramu n nivedita….learnt a lot there!!

June – Orthopedics unit 2…those who know about it ‘ll realize about the ilizarovs n the dressings….stood long hours in ot holding the patients limb assisting dr.shah in ilizarov surgeries n went back to ward to the dressings of the same…duties were really good working with good pgs n learnt suturing wounds in casualty…

July – Off to Kaiwara for the rural postings….staying away from home for a month…getting up at 8-9…sitting in opd at phc…going for field work…eating bhatta’s food… trekking…started reading for the PG entrance sincerely with some group discussions….was fun..

Aug – Urban postings at the MK nagar health centre….trying to dispose off the medications due to get expired that month to the same old singh n tamilian families….hard kaur, nand kaur, harbhajan singh, akmalunnisa, n many more……i can start off a clinic in that area knowing so many people..

Sep – Medicine brought new work…taking patients to new hospital to get CT scan done…write notes on n on…..getting psyched up talking to psychiatry patients…went to old age homes as a part of the Joy of Giving week…worst of all was to listen the sisters say ” sir…aayamma is not there…so please do this job”:)

Oct – A n E…working for 12 hours a day…was very hectic…seeing patients with cold n cough at 3 in the night….gang-war case at 2 am with rowdies involved n calling the sadashivnagar police to help us n take them away…..convincing the patients attenders the need of ICU care for low platelets….asking them to take them to another hospital…getting blasted from them…n then chilling out in ophthal for the next 15 days asking patients to read out snellens chart n putting eyedrops in drops duties….

Nov – Back to medicine again….same old work....only change was working with new n better pgs…

Dec – Working in Plastic surgery…assisting most of the cases mopping n cauterizing n seeing how subtly they handle the skin n the soft tissue…nice experience!! Did night duty in surgery on the 31st…cutting cake in the parking lot to welcome the new yr 2010…was the first time ever I celebrated a new year :)

January – Dermat and Ent…nothing much about the depts….entrance exam time…back to serious studying after quite some time!!

February – working in the new block of MSR teaching hospital in OT in anaesthesia postings…giving spinals,intubations,i.v lines….Internship is about to end in another 2 weeks and looking back into it, I wonder if internship itself is all about managing being a ward boy, ot boy, attender, sister, brother n all apart from being a DOCTOR or only if I managed to do it that way!!!
